Court forfeits cash bond of theft suspect
THE Regional Trial Court (RTC) forfeited the cash bond of a theft suspect after he failed to appear in last week's arraignment.
RTC Branch 15 Judge Jesus V. Quitain also issued a warrant of arrest against one Ricardo Solinap, 42, resident of San Francisco de Asis in Matina, Davao City for his failure to appear in court on September 12 despite notice sent to him.
One Benjamin Otara, 30, of Sitio Escuela in Catalunan Grande, originally filed the charges against Solinap, who has posted a surety bond before the court.
In his affidavit complaint, Otara said he was on his way to work onboard a passenger jeepney at around 9:30 a.m. on August 11 when the incident happened.
Upon reaching Ecoland, particularly in front of the Department of Agrarian Reform office, an unidentified man seated beside him told the driver to stop.
The man, Otara said, hurriedly walked towards Sandawa road, prompting him to suspect something.
Checking on his things, he noticed that his Nokia 3230 cellular phone worth P13,500 that was placed inside his pocket was already missing.
Otara said he alighted from the vehicle and chased the man.
The man, later identified as Solinap, was arrested by a traffic enforcer who was in the area.
Otara's phone was recovered from the suspect.
Solinap was then brought to the Talomo police for investigation. (JGRS)
